Well, how about a simple question: do you really need RAC? Moans asked it quite a few years ago, but afaik few actually provided an answer.

I'm continually told by the "experts" that I need to have RAC in my DW.
Our DW had 0 (that is Z-E-R-O!) unscheduled downtime in the last 3 years.
Scheduled outages, two were for Oracle patches that needed to be installed (20 minutes in total) and one was for an Aix upgrade and patching of our Power6 box - the whole system, not just the DW lpars (half a day).
Our DW does 8TB of I/O per day - that's 100MB/s continuous sustained 24/7, in case maths fail anyone - so it's most definitely not a toy setup.

Now, I know that a bank here in NSW has installed a monster RAC system at a cost of hundreds of millions and since then had at least three unscheduled outages that were publicly reported, let alone all the niggly patching they had to go through to get the blessed thing working.

I kinda think that three scheduled outages in 3 years and 0 (zero) unscheduled beats all that RAC paraphernalia any day, at orders of magnitude lesser cost. But who am I to claim such? Heck: I'm not even an "ace" - and will never be one! - so what credibility do I have?
